Is Jacksonville FL the biggest city?

December 14, 2021 by Bridget Gibson

Jacksonville is the most populous city in Florida, and is the largest city by area in the contiguous United States as of 2020. It is the seat of Duval County, with which the city government consolidated in 1968. Is Jacksonville Florida The largest city in the world? The largest city in Florida is Jacksonville, with […]

What is the most expensive neighborhood in Jacksonville?

December 14, 2021 by Sadie Daniel

The Isle of Palms, the intracoastal neighborhood sandwiched between Beach Boulevard and JTB, is also the most expensive place in Jacksonville to buy a home with a single-family home averaging around $446,500. How many counties are in Jacksonville?

December 14, 2021 by Bridget Gibson

seven. Our region encompasses seven distinctive counties in Northeast Florida – Baker, Clay, Duval, Flagler, Nassau, Putnam and St. Johns. What’s the coldest day in Jacksonville Florida?

December 14, 2021 by Trevor Zboncak

“The lowest temperature ever recorded in Jacksonville, Florida was on February 8, 1835 when it fell to 8 degrees F. Scarcely a winter passes without a temperature at some time as low as freezing.
